Abstract

The utility model provides an angle-adjustable display device and an integrated computer. The display device comprises a base, a displayer, a horizontal angle adjusting device and a pitching angle adjusting device. The horizontal angle adjusting device comprises a first motor, a transmission gear assembly and a cover body. The first motor comprises a first motor shaft and a driving gear formed at the tail end of the first motor shaft, and a section of rack is formed on the transmission gear assembly. The pitching angle adjusting device comprises a second motor installed on the back of the displayer and an inserting part formed on one side of the cover body. And the tail end of a second motor shaft of the second motor is fixedly arranged on the inserting part. When the second motor operates, the display is driven to do pitching motion, and the driving gear is matched with the rack to drive the display to rotate horizontally. Therefore, through the simple structural design, the display angle of the display can be automatically adjusted.

Technical field

[0001] The utility model relates to the field of displays, and in particular to an angle-adjustable display device and an integrated computer. [Background Technology]

[0002] Most all-in-one computers in the prior art have either a pitch or a horizontal adjustment function for the display, but cannot adjust both the pitch and horizontal angles simultaneously. Furthermore, existing angle adjustment mechanisms are typically manual, lacking automated adjustment capabilities and intelligent or remote control capabilities.

[0003] In addition, the prior art also discloses a display viewing angle adjustment device that uses a horizontal angle adjustment device to adjust the horizontal angle of the screen and a pitch angle adjustment device to adjust the pitch angle of the screen. However, the structures and driving methods of the horizontal angle adjustment device and the pitch angle adjustment device are relatively complex.

[0004] Therefore, it is urgent to propose a new technical solution to solve the above problems. [Utility Model Content]

[0005] One of the purposes of the present invention is to provide an angle-adjustable display device and an all-in-one computer, which can automatically adjust the pitch angle and horizontal angle of the display through a simple structural design.

[0006] According to one aspect of the present invention, the present invention provides an angle-adjustable display device, comprising: a base; a display; a horizontal angle adjustment device for adjusting the horizontal angle of the display, comprising a first motor fixed to the base, a transmission gear assembly, and a cover fixed to the transmission gear assembly, wherein the first motor comprises a first body, a first motor shaft, and a driving gear formed at the end of the first motor shaft, a rack formed on the transmission gear assembly, and the transmission gear assembly and the cover are rotatably assembled on the base; a pitch angle adjustment device for adjusting the pitch angle of the display, comprising a second motor mounted on the back of the display and a plug-in portion formed on one side of the cover, the second motor comprising a second body and a second motor shaft, the end of the second motor shaft being fixedly disposed on the plug-in portion, and when the second motor is in operation, the second body rotates relative to the second motor shaft, thereby driving the display to perform a pitch motion, wherein the driving gear cooperates with the rack on the transmission gear assembly to drive the transmission gear assembly and the cover to rotate, thereby driving the display to rotate horizontally.

[0007] According to another aspect of the present invention, an all-in-one computer is provided, comprising: a display device and a host. The display device comprises: a base; a display; a horizontal angle adjustment device for adjusting the horizontal angle of the display, comprising a first motor fixed to the base, a transmission gear assembly, and a cover fixed to the transmission gear assembly, wherein the first motor comprises a first body, a first motor shaft, and a driving gear formed at the end of the first motor shaft, the transmission gear assembly having a rack formed thereon, and the transmission gear assembly and the cover being rotatably assembled to the base; and a pitch angle adjustment device for adjusting the pitch angle of the display, comprising a second motor mounted on the back of the display and a plug-in portion formed on one side of the cover, the second motor comprising a second body and a second motor shaft, the end of the second motor shaft being fixed to the plug-in portion, and when the second motor is in operation, the second body rotates relative to the second motor shaft, thereby driving the display to pitch, wherein the driving gear cooperates with the rack on the transmission gear assembly to drive the transmission gear assembly and the cover to rotate, thereby driving the display to rotate horizontally. The host is arranged in the base or in the display.

[0008] Compared with the prior art, the present invention realizes pitch angle adjustment of the display through the cooperation of the second motor installed on the back of the display and the plug-in portion formed on one side of the cover body, and realizes horizontal angle adjustment of the display through the cooperation of the driving gear of the first motor and the rack on the transmission gear assembly. Its structure is simple and can automatically adjust the pitch angle and horizontal angle of the display.

The horizontal angle adjustment device 130 includes a first motor 131 fixed to the base 110, a transmission gear assembly 132, and a cover 133 fixed to the transmission gear assembly 132. The first motor 131 includes a first body 1313, a first motor shaft 1311, and a driving gear 1312 formed at the end of the first motor shaft 1311. A rack 1321 is formed on the transmission gear assembly 132. The transmission gear assembly 132 and the cover 133 are rotatably assembled on the base 110. The driving gear 1312 cooperates with the rack 1321 on the transmission gear assembly 132 to drive the transmission gear set 132 and the cover 133 to rotate, thereby driving the display 120 to rotate horizontally. In one example, when the first motor 131 rotates forward, the display 120 rotates horizontally to the left, and when the first motor 131 rotates reversely, the display 120 rotates horizontally to the right. In this way, by controlling the forward and reverse rotation of the motor 131, the horizontal angle of the display 120 can be accurately adjusted.

[0025] like Figure 6 and 7 As shown, the rack on the transmission gear assembly 132 is an internal rack, the driving gear 1312 is an external gear, and the driving gear 1312 at the end of the first motor shaft 1311 is located in the motion space 1322 formed inside the transmission gear assembly 132.

[0026] like Figure 7 As shown, the transmission gear assembly 132 includes a ring piece 1323 and a stop bar 1324 connecting a first inner position and a second inner position of the ring piece 1323. A portion of the inner side of the ring piece 1323 forms the rack 1321, and the movement space 1322 is formed between the rack 1321 and the stop bar 1324. The stop bar 1324 limits the driving gear 1312 between the first inner position and the second inner position of the ring piece 1323.

[0027] like Figure 6 and 7 As shown, the cover body 133 includes an annular cover wall 1331, an annular edge 1332 formed at the end of the cover wall 1331, and a connecting portion 1333 formed from one side of the cover wall 1331. The annular edge 1332 is fixed to the ring piece 1323, for example, the two can be fixed together by screws, rivets, buckles, etc.

[0028] like Figure 6 and 7As shown, the annular edge 1332 and the ring piece 1323 are housed within the base 110, and the cover wall 1331 extends toward the top of the base 110 and into the opening. The connecting portion 1333 is located outside the base 110. The connecting portion 1333 and the annular edge 1332 clamp the edge of the top opening of the base 110, so that the ring piece 1323 and the cover body 133 are rotatably assembled to the base 110. In alternative embodiments, other methods can be used to rotatably assemble the transmission gear assembly 132 and the cover body 133 to the base 110. For example, a track for the transmission gear assembly 132 to slide can be provided within the base 110, and the transmission gear assembly 132 can be rotatably assembled on the track. The ring piece 1323 is placed horizontally, and the first motor 131 is placed vertically, so that the first motor shaft 1311 is also placed vertically, that is, the ring piece 1323 is parallel to the horizontal plane, and the extension direction of the first motor 131 and the extension direction of the first motor shaft 1311 are parallel to the z-axis.

[0030] Figure 8 for Figure 1 3D exploded view of the pitch angle adjustment device 130 in the all-in-one computer. Figure 8 As shown, the pitch angle adjustment device 130 includes a second motor 141 installed on the back of the display 120 and a plug-in portion 142 formed on one side of the cover body 133. The second motor 141 includes a second body 1411 and a second motor shaft 1412. The end of the second motor shaft 1412 is fixedly arranged on the plug-in portion 142. When the second motor 141 is running, the second body 1411 rotates relative to the second motor shaft 1412, thereby driving the display 120 to perform a pitch movement. In one example, when the second motor 141 rotates forward, the display 120 tilts upward, and when the second motor 141 rotates reversely, the display 120 tilts downward. In this way, by controlling the forward and reverse rotation of the second motor 141, the pitch angle of the display 120 can be accurately adjusted.

[0031] like Figure 8 As shown, the plug-in portion 142 is formed at the end of the connecting portion 1333 of the cover body 133. Specifically, there are two plug-in portions 142, which are spaced apart. An inserting hole 1421 is formed on the inner side of each plug-in portion. The second motor 141 is located between the two plug-in portions 142, and the end of the second motor shaft 1412 is fixedly disposed in the inserting hole 1421 of the plug-in portion 142.

[0032] In an alternative embodiment, there may be only one plug-in portion 142. In an alternative embodiment, the plug-in portion 142 may be directly formed on the cover wall 1331 of the cover body 133, and the connecting portion 1333 may not be provided.

[0033] like Figure 8 As shown, the display 120 includes a display back cover 121 and a motor fixing base 144. The second motor 141 is horizontally mounted on the display back cover 121, and the second motor shaft 1412 of the second motor 141 is horizontally placed, that is, the extension direction of the second motor 141 is parallel to the horizontal plane, and the extension direction of the second motor shaft 1412 is parallel to the horizontal plane.

[0034] The back of the display back cover 121 is formed with an outwardly protruding mounting protrusion 143. A mounting slot 145 is formed within the mounting protrusion 143 and opens to the front of the display back cover. Mounting holes 146 are formed through the two sidewalls of the mounting protrusion 143. The motor fixing base 144 includes a mounting portion 1441 and a fixing portion 1442 that extends from the mounting portion 1441 into the mounting slot 145 and fixes the second body 1411.

[0035] The mounting portion 1441 is mounted on the opening of the mounting slot 145 by means of screws 1443. In other embodiments, the mounting portion 1441 may be mounted on the opening of the mounting slot 145 by other existing methods.

[0036] The distal end of the second motor shaft 1412 passes through the mounting hole 146 and is fixedly disposed in the insertion hole 1421 of the insertion portion 142. It should be noted that when the second motor 141 is operating, the distal end of the second motor shaft 1412 remains fixed in the insertion hole 1421 of the insertion portion 142 and does not rotate. Therefore, the second body 1411 needs to rotate relative to the second motor shaft 1412. The second body 1411 drives the display back cover 121 to rotate along the second motor shaft 1412, thereby driving the display 120 to adjust its pitch angle.

[0037] In an optional embodiment, the second motor 141 may be fixedly mounted on the display back cover 121 in various other conventional ways, such as directly fixing the second motor 141 to the back of the display back cover 121 via a fixing device.

[0038] In the present invention, the pitch angle of the display 120 can be adjusted solely by the pitch angle adjustment device 140, such as tilting it up or down. The horizontal angle of the display 120 can also be adjusted solely by the horizontal angle adjustment device 130, such as turning it left or right. Furthermore, both the pitch angle and horizontal angle can be adjusted simultaneously by the pitch angle adjustment device 140 and the horizontal angle adjustment device 130, such as tilting it up and turning it right at the same time. In other words, the all-in-one computer of the present invention is equipped with a dual-axis rotation structure, which can adjust the pitch angle and horizontal angle of the display, ensuring smooth rotation of the display in different directions.

[0039] In a preferred embodiment, the display device in the all-in-one computer may further include a controller (not shown). The controller is electrically connected to the first motor and / or the second motor. The controller can drive the first motor 131 and / or the second motor 141 as needed or according to preset rules, thereby automatically adjusting the horizontal angle and / or pitch angle of the display 120. For example, a user can connect to the controller through a matching remote control device (such as a mobile phone application) and then control the display angle of the display 120, thereby achieving remote angle adjustment. For another example, a user can send instructions to the controller based on a local application or button, so that the controller controls the display angle of the display 120.

[0040] In a preferred embodiment, the display device in the all-in-one computer may further include one or more sensors. The sensors are electrically connected to the controller. The sensors may be microphones, cameras, temperature sensors, infrared sensors, radars, passive infrared sensors (PIR sensors), and the like. The controller drives the first motor and / or the second motor based on the sensor signals from the sensors, thereby automatically adjusting the horizontal and / or vertical angles of the display. For example, the camera captures a user, and the controller detects the user's position based on the image captured by the camera. After the user moves, the controller drives the first motor and / or the second motor based on the user's position, thereby ensuring that the display always faces the user. In another example, the microphone captures the user's voice, and the controller detects the user's position based on the voice captured by the microphone. Based on the user's position, the controller drives the first motor and / or the second motor, thereby ensuring that the display always faces the user. In this way, through the sensors and the controller, the computer can automatically adjust the angle of the display according to the usage environment.
